OTOROHANGA STOCK SALE. The New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Co., Ltd., Hamilton, report as follows on their Otorohanga stock sale held on Wednesday:—ln all departments conditions were normal. There was a fair representation of butchers' cattle, with a majority of unfinished and stores yarded. There were a number of odd lots of young cattle entered as well. Realisations were about equal to this week's Frankton rates and a complete clearance resulted. The class of the medium entry of dairy cows was, generally, poorer. Consequently competition was not extra brisk, though prices were satisfactory. Heavy S.H. fat cows £7 2s 6d to £8 ss; medium do £5 15s to £6 15s; good quality Jersey cows £4 12s 6d to £5 7s 6d; medium £4 2s 6d to £4 10s; unfinished forward conditioned Jersey cows £3 5s to £4; heavy boners £2 12s 6d to £3 2s 6d; others up to £2 10s; yearling heifers up to £3 12s; medium dairy cows £5 to £6 10s; others up to £5.

Sheep.—The market was quite good, but the entry was fairly small. ' Medium fat wethers made up to 275; heavy fat ewes 23s to 26s 3d; light up to 22s 6d; 2 extra prime lambs £2 0s 6d; good quality fat lambs 22s to 245; forward up to 21s; pen of s.m. breeding ewes 29s 9d. Pigs.—The entry was fairly moderate and comprised sows, light porkers and store pigs. Bidding maintained prices about equal to those current at other centres and all sold readily. Plain class sow pigs up to £2 lis; light porkers 29s to 30s; good store pigs 19s to 245; medium 15s to 18s; slips lis to 14s; weaners up to 10s. I
